Job Title: Summer St. Olaf Dive Camp Counselor (WS-NST-E) Classification: Student Employee (non-exempt) Name and Address of Employer: St. Olaf College, 1520 St. Olaf Ave, Northfield, MN 55057 If the position requires the student to work off campus, provide the name and address here: Department Name:  College Events – St. Olaf Dive Camp Cost Center and Activity: 13503-13469 Length of Position: July 12-16, 2026 Contact Person/Supervisor:  Diving Coach Wage Range: $18.75 / hour Description of the Position: (Purpose of the Position):  The Dive Camp Counselor role supports all aspects of camp including supervision, instructional support, coaching, recreational activities, and camp operations. Transferable Skills:  1. Analytical skills  2. Youth leadership  3. Verbal communication  Duties and Responsibilities:  * Support camper check-in and check-out: welcoming families and assisting with College Events as needed. * Wake campers each morning; conduct room checks each evening.  * Provide sport-specific instruction and training under the direction of the head coach.  * Organize and/or assist with daily activities. * Provide supervision of campers at assigned activities, both instructional and recreational, for the duration of the camp session(s). * Be onsite and reachable throughout the duration of camp (and on campus during overnight hours).  * Apply basic youth development principles in working with students through inclusivity, communication, relationship development, and respect. * Be aware of and implement all safety guidelines. Follow and uphold all security rules and procedures. * Maintain high standards of health and safety in all activities for campers. * Interact with people from a diversity of backgrounds and experience. * Perform other duties as assigned. Qualifications: (Education/Experience/Skills)  Applicants should have a background in competitive diving and working with youth. Physical and Environmental Factors: This position requires crouching, kneeling/crawling, twisting/pivoting, climbing/balancing, reaching overhead, grasping/handling, pushing/pulling, lifting and carrying objects up to 20 lbs., and repetitive motions to perform the essential functions. It also requires exposure to loud noise, respiratory factors, chemicals, wet or humid conditions indoors, proximity hazards, and heights or cramped quarters to perform the essential functions. Candidates must possess the ability to safely perform the physical work required of all duties with or without reasonable accommodation.
